#4eb59f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4eb59f is composed of 30.6% red, 71% green and 62.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 12.2%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 167.2 degrees, a saturation of 41% and a lightness of 50.8%. #4eb59f color hex could be obtained by blending #9cffff with #006b3f.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

#4eb59f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4eb59f has RGB values of R:78, G:181, B:159 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.12,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 5158303.
